    SubjectRe: [PATCH 22/22 v4] Input: atmel_mxt_ts - parse T6 reports
    On Mon, Jun 18, 2012 at 11:09 PM, Nick Dyer <nick.dyer@itdev.co.uk> wrote:
    > Daniel Kurtz wrote:
    >> The normal messages sent after boot or NVRAM update are T6 reports,
    >> containing a status, and the config memory checksum.  Parse them and dump
    >> a useful info message.
    >
    > This can cause a lot of dmesg output - for instance you get 2 messages per
    > calibration, and the chip can trigger them itself if noise suppression or
    > anti-touch calibration are enabled. So perhaps dev_dbg()?

    Sounds good to me.
